Quick Summary

The Department of the Army, through the W7NR USPFO ACTIVITY NYANG 105, is soliciting quotes for the Construction of a Main Gate Canopy (Project # WHAY202001) at the 105th Airlift Wing, Stewart ANGB, Newburgh, NY. This is a Total Small Business Set-Aside opportunity. Quotes are due by May 29, 2026, at 11:00 AM EST.

Scope of Work

The project requires the contractor to furnish all personnel, equipment, tools, materials, supervision, and quality control to construct a permanent, all-weather overhead canopy at the Main Gate Entry Control Point (ECP). Key tasks include:

  • Construction of the canopy structure, including excavation, concrete foundations, structural steel, metal roofing, gutters, downspouts, and electrical work (conduit, wiring, lighting, power connection).
  • Modifications to existing perimeter fencing, including demolition, removal, and installation of new posts, fabric, and gates.
  • Curb realignment and associated site work, such as saw-cutting, removal of existing curbs, grading, concrete pouring, asphalt paving, and pavement markings. All work must adhere to project design drawings and specifications (Project WHAY202001, Main Gate Overhang, 100% B3 Submittal, dated 20 APR 2023).

Contract & Timeline

  • Contract Type: Firm Fixed Price (FFP)
  • NAICS Code: 236220 (Construction Of Other Non Building Facilities)
  • Small Business Size Standard: $45 million average annual revenue.
  • Project Magnitude: Between $250,000 and $500,000.
  • Period of Performance: 180 calendar days from notice to proceed.
  • Response Due: May 29, 2026, 11:00 AM EST.
  • Published Date: April 29, 2026.
  • Set-Aside: Total Small Business Set-Aside (FAR 19.5).

Submission & Evaluation

  • Submission Method: Electronically via email to joseph.kugler.1@us.af.mil.
  • Evaluation Factors: Price and Technical Capability (Past Experience and Project Schedule).
  • Award Basis: Lowest priced quote that conforms to requirements and meets or exceeds acceptability standards for non-cost factors.
  • SAM Registration: Offerors must be registered in SAM.gov prior to quote submission.
  • Pre-Proposal Conference & Site Visit: Scheduled for May 20, 2026, at 10:00 AM EST at the Civil Engineering Squadron Conference Room, Building # 207, 105th Airlift Wing, Stewart ANGB. Pre-registration is required; instructions are in the SF 1442.

Additional Notes

Funds are not presently available, and the award is contingent upon the appropriation of funds. All quotes and associated documents must be in English. Incomplete quotes will not be accepted.
